Although those of us who have bought apts on phase 1 are getting ready for completion, this development is not likely to be fully completed for another six months or so after that.  I am therefore presuming that Gardens of Manilva won't feature in the OVP travel bruchure until 2009.  (I do realise that assuming is dangerous so if anyone has any information to the contrary, please share :D)

So I wondered what the general thoughts are on this? 

I for one can't afford to pay a mortgage for a year until I might get some rental, so we have to make the investment start paying straight away.  So it follows on then that if I have to rent it out myself anyway for at least a year - why would I buy the OVP furniture package, pay their commissions/management charges etc etc etc.

I can get a nice furniture package for 9,000 Euro, have been recommended an excellent air con company and have a great contact in property management .  I am also going to use www.gardensofmanilva.com to offer rental.  So this is the route I'm taking as I feel I will have more control.

We managed several properties on behalf of owners here and here are the issues.

OVP rented the properties without telling the owners. Keeping 100% of the money.

On one occassion the idiots charged for a clean and a car hire, when questioned they said it was for the rental. The statement showed the clean charges etc, but no rental!!!

They charge to oil locks on doors, that they do not do.

they charge to hold the keys each month, an extortionate ammount.

When keys are requested, they claim not to have autorisation even when I have a printed email showing the owner had sent it to that person at OVP and copied me in.

They charge 180 euros a night for a poor property and then claim that market conditions are stopping rental programs working! They still charge teh key holding during this period.

They still charge to oil locks in this period, yet when trying to access many locks are siezed or rusted.

Enough facts for one posting.

ther to pieboys mail regarding,OVP rentals.I to have a property in Duquesa which I visit regulary and on two occasions have noticed (as i always log the electricity useage ) that it had increased significantly, and on one occasion by over 150 units!! And we had only left three weeks earlier.
On challenging them, they said a light must have been left on! I said if that was the case I must be paying for all the lights in the complex! And I always switch the electricity supply off prior to leaving!
The second time it happened we were not so believing,to be then informed after several conversations that we had had two days rental.The increase in useage reflected that whoever was staying at the property must have had every electrical appliance on for 24hrs/day.
Or more likely they had been for much longer."BUT HOW DO WE PROVE IT " :cry:
